Layer 3 routed traffic for supported protocols is not
impacted during a Hitless management event. Traffic
will converge to normalcy after the new active module
becomes operational.
Other Layer 3 protocols that are not supported will be
interrupted during the switchover or failover.
If BGP4+ graceful restart or OSPF graceful restart /
OSPFv3 NSR is enabled, it will be gracefully restarted
and traffic will converge to normalcy after the new
active module becomes operational. For details about
OSPFv3 graceful restart, refer to “OSPF v3 graceful
restart” section in the FastIron Ethernet Switch Layer 3
Routing Configuration Guide. For details about BGP4
graceful restart, refer to “BGP4+graceful restart”
section in the FastIron Ethernet Switch Layer 3 Routing
Configuration Guide.
Configured ACLs will operate in a hitless manner.
Management traffic N/A All existing management sessions (SNMP, TELNET,
HTTP, HTTPS, FTP, TFTP, SSH etc.), are interrupted
during the switchover or failover process. All such
sessions are terminated and can be re-established
after the new Active Controller takes over.

Supported security protocols and services are not
impacted during a switchover or failover.
NOTE: If 802.1X and multi-device port authentication
are enabled together on the same port, both
will be impacted during a switchover or failover.
Hitless support for these features applies to
ports with 802.1X only or multi-device port
authentication only.
Configured ACLs will operate in a hitless manner,
meaning the system will continue to permit and deny
traffic during the switchover or failover process.

Supported protocols and services are not impacted
during a switchover or failover.
DNS lookups will continue after a switchover or failover.
This information is not synchronized.
Ping traffic will be minimally impacted.
